== Biography ==
'''Father''' Gui, Seneschal of Champagne, Seigneur de Longueville, Braine, & Baudmont d. 1144
'''Mother''' Alix d. a 1144
Agnes de Longueville Countess of Braine-sur-Vesle, Dame de Fere-en-Tardenois, de Pontarcis, de Nestle, de Loungueville, and de Quincy.
She married Milon III, Comte de Bar-sur-Seine, son of Guy II de Brienne, Comte de Bar-sur-Seine and Petronille de Chacenay.4 Agnes de Longueville was born circa 1130 at France.Douglas Richardson, Royal Ancestry, Vol. II, p. 467-468
She married Robert I 'the Great', Comte de Perche, Seneschal of Champagne, Seigneur de Belleme, Longueville, Braine, & Baudmont, son of Louis VI 'the Fat', King of France and Alix (Adelais) de Maurienne, circa December 1152; They had 6 sons (Robert II, Comte de Dreux & Barine-sur-Vesle; Henri, Bishop of Orleans; Philippe, Bishop of Beauvais, Vidame de Gerberoy; Guillaume, Seigneur de Brie-Comte-Robert, Torcy, & Chilly; Pierre; & Jean) & 4 daughters (Alix, wife of Raoul I, Seigneur de Coucy; Isabelle, wife of Hugues III, Seigneur de Broyes-Commercy & Chateauvillain; Massilie (or Beatrix or Basilie), a nun at Charmes Priory & Wareville Priory; & Marguerite, a nun at Charmes Priory).Douglas Richardson, Royal Ancestry, Vol. III, p. 20.
Agnes de Longueville died on 24 July 1204 at France; Buried in the church of the Abbey of St.-Yved, Braine.http://our-royal-titled-noble-and-commoner-ancestors.com/p158.htm#i4752,/
